Output d334dfd41528257a94f632c66a0b2f1047941800f732d2c729af6a55f5182825:0

value
21300
script pubkey
OP_0 OP_PUSHBYTES_32 109e73abffa074775e1d06ef5c84b68e9011e5a87d7c7037faa1f3145b04b4f9
address
tb1qzz0882ll5p68whsaqmh4ep9k36gpredg0478qdl658e3gkcyknusknarp4
transaction
d334dfd41528257a94f632c66a0b2f1047941800f732d2c729af6a55f5182825
confirmations
60981
spent
true